Description
Temporary residents in Canada
A quick review of temporary residence applications (TRVs, Study Permits and Work Permits)
eTA - Electronic Travel Authorization
Temporary Resident Permits – inadmissibility, overstay
Ethical issues
when the consultant knows the “true” purpose of the stay
misrepresentation and consequences
honesty and candour
managing client’s expectations
competence, experience, knowledge
Dual intent applicants
Work permits
Where to apply
Business visitors and other work without a Work Permit
Common LMIA exemptions
Spousal permits
Open work permits
Post-graduation work permit
PR applicants (spousal sponsorship, caregivers, refugees)
Study permits
Where to apply
Students and work permits
Study without a study permit
Spousal permits
Visitors
Rights and responsibilities of visitors to Canada
Super visa
Implied status
Rules
Terms and conditions
Extending work status following an application for permanent residence
Extending or changing temporary status (student to work, work to student, visitor to work or student, work and study)
Criminal or medical inadmissibility affecting temporary residents already in Canada
Restoration
Restoration after a refused application
Ethical issues
Competency of counsel
Managing client’s expectations
Extending temporary status through meritless applications
Due diligence
Maintaining a file (future applications, potential complaints)
